  • Abstract
    To aim at the network delays in the networked control systems, an internal model control algorithm is proposed. This method makes that the network delays don´t need to be measured, identified or estimated on line, and the nodes don´t need the clock signal synchronization. Moreover, it adapts to the environment which has random, variant and uncertain delays, more than dozens of sampling periods, some data packets loss, the change of controlled plant in the networked control system. The results of the simulation show the validity of the control scheme, and indicate the system has better dynamic performance and robustness.
